SERVICE 5.4.1 FLUIDS & MAINTENANCE Grease (SANDEVIL) Use SAE multi-purpose high temperature grease for all applications. SAE multi- purpose lithium base grease is also acceptable.
USE ONLY CLEAN LUBRICANTS 5.6 Servicing Interval
The SANDEVIL requires approximately 10 shots of grease to each fitting upon the completion of the set up. 1. DO NOT OVER GREASE

7 SPECIFICATION
SANDEVIL BT-SD06 Length: 58” (front to back) includes caster wheels and mounting linkage Width: 69” (left to right) including anti - scalping rollers Height: 38” Includes height adjustment handle Weight: Approximately 295 lbs. Tires: 3 caster wheels – 9 x 3.50-4 (non-pneumatic ) Input Power: Attached to the Model KB Blower ___________________________________________________________________________________________________

The SANDEVIL attachment from Buffalo Turbine is capable of improving your aerification process on the golf course in addition to minimizing the damage to the turf. The SANDEVIL is designed to use the “Turbine Powered Air” produced by the Model KB blower to evenly spread top dressing material into aerification holes up to ½. In dry conditions, a minimum of 3 passes may be needed to fill the aerification holes. Larger holes and moist condition require additional passes. Turbine powered air is diverted and baffled downward forcing the top dressing material into aerification holes or thatch. The height adjustment (lever) along with the nylon bristled skirting is designed to help contain the top dressing material and turbine powered air within the confines of the lower housing. WHEN FILLING AERIFICATION HOLES, POSITION THE HEIGHT ADJUSTMENT LEVER TO THE STTING WHERE THE NYLON BRISTLES ARE JUST TOUCHING (OR SLIGHTLY ABOVE) THE PUTTING GREEN SURFACE. POSITIONING THE SANDEVIL UNIT TO ITS LOWEST SETTING WILL REDUCE OR STARVE THE AIR FLOW PRODUCED FROM THE TURBINE TO THE SANDEVIL ATTACHMENT. The heavy-duty steel construction and caster wheels combined with the powder-coated finish translates to minimal maintenance requirements. In a matter of minutes the SANDEVIL is easily attached to any Buffalo Turbine Model KB blower unit.
